What is White Water Rafting?

White water rafting is an outdoor recreational activity that involves navigating a river or body of water with the use of an inflatable raft. It typically takes place in rivers with rapid currents and varying degrees of difficulty. Participants paddle the raft and work together as a team to maneuver through the rapids, obstacles, and waves.

While white water rafting can provide an adrenaline rush and a unique way to experience nature, it is important to be aware of the potential risks involved. These risks include capsizing, getting trapped under the raft or in debris, and injuries from collisions with rocks or other objects in the water.

Understanding the Risks of White Water Rafting

While the chances of dying from white water rafting are relatively low, it is still important to understand the risks involved. These risks include:

  • Capsizing and being thrown into the water
  • Getting trapped under the raft or in debris
  • Injuries from collisions with rocks or other objects in the water
  • Hypothermia from cold water immersion

By being aware of these risks and taking necessary precautions, you can minimize the chances of accidents or injuries while white water rafting.

What is Numbing and How Does It Work?

Numbing, or local anesthesia, is a common practice in dentistry. It involves the use of a medication that temporarily blocks the nerves in a specific area, preventing them from sending pain signals to the brain. This allows the dentist to perform procedures such as fillings, extractions, or root canals without causing any pain or discomfort to the patient. The local anesthetic is usually administered through an injection, but in some cases, a numbing gel or spray may be used to numb the area before the injection.

Further Explanation of Numbing

Local anesthesia works by blocking the nerve signals that transmit pain to the brain. The medication is injected near the nerve, where it temporarily disrupts the function of the nerve fibers. This prevents the nerve from sending pain signals to the brain, resulting in a numbing effect in the surrounding area. The numbness typically lasts for a few hours, allowing the dentist to complete the procedure without causing any pain or discomfort to the patient.

Question and Answer: When to Sue a Dentist

Q: What is the statute of limitations for filing a dental malpractice lawsuit?

A: The statute of limitations for dental malpractice lawsuits varies by jurisdiction. It is essential to consult with a legal professional to understand the specific time limits in your area.

Q: What types of damages can be awarded in a dental malpractice lawsuit?

A: Damages in dental malpractice lawsuits can include compensation for medical expenses, pain and suffering, lost wages, and future medical care.

Q: Can I sue my dentist for a bad outcome even if it was a known risk?

A: It depends on the specific circumstances. While some procedures carry inherent risks, dentists have a duty to inform patients of these risks and obtain informed consent. If the dentist failed to do so or acted negligently, you may have a valid claim.

Q: How long does a dental malpractice lawsuit typically take?

A: The duration of a dental malpractice lawsuit can vary depending on factors such as the complexity of the case, the need for expert witnesses, and court availability. Some cases may be resolved in a matter of months, while others can take several years.
